    38 East 70th Street

    Available July 15th. Designed by famed architect Charles Graham circa 1884, this exquisite five-story townhouse offers approximately 5,000 square feet of stunning original splendor with six bedrooms and four and a half baths in excellent condition, steps from Central Park.

    Occupied by the same family since 1907 and lovingly preserved, this Italianate brownstone features dramatically high ceilings, sun-filled southern and northern exposures, restored original woodwork, 3 skylights and 8 fireplaces that prominently showcase a unique characteristic in each room.

    Enter through an elegant foyer to the grand parlor level featuring 12’ ceilings and 3 wood burning fireplaces featured in the formal gallery, living room and sitting room. The large formal dining room showcases a skylight and butler’s pantry with functioning dumbwaiter. The garden level with direct street access boasts a superb Chef’s kitchen and breakfast room, den, powder room and small private garden. The top three floors each feature two large bedrooms and a full bath. Each floor offers beautiful original details such as crown moldings, oversized windows with embrasured shutters and large bay windows. A basement with abundant storage, washer/dryer and an additional full bath complete this desirable floorplan.

    Outfitted with state-of-the-art communications and alarm systems, central air conditioning and a fifty-case wine cellar, 38 East 70th Street marries the inimitable charm of a bygone era with every modern convenience. Located on a prime block within the Upper East Side Historic District, this spectacular home is steps from Madison Avenue’s fine restaurants, shops, museums and Central Park.
